本文介绍使用Java语言实现的逢一进一高效分页公式:
复制代码
1
2int totalPage = (totalCount - 1) / pageSize + 1;
逢一进一
在十进制中,每一位有0~9共十个数码,所以计数的基数为10。超过9就必须用多位数来表示。十制数的运算遵循:加法时,“逢十进一 —— 该数位上的数满十就向前一位进一”;减法时,“借一当十 —— 该数位上的数不够减时,就向前一位借一当做十,再相减”。
请参考以下代码片段:
复制代码
1
2
3
4
5
6
7
8public static void main(String[] args) { // 逢一进一高效分页公式:总页数 = (总条数 - 1) / 每页查询条数 + 1 int totalCount = 101; int pageSize = 10; int totalPage = (totalCount - 1) / pageSize + 1; System.out.println(totalPage); // 11 }
本文首发于个人独立博客,文章链接:http://www.zebe.me/java-effective-paging-formula
最后
以上就是愉快黄蜂最近收集整理的关于Java逢一进一高效分页公式的全部内容,更多相关Java逢一进一高效分页公式内容请搜索靠谱客的其他文章。
本图文内容来源于网友提供,作为学习参考使用,或来自网络收集整理,版权属于原作者所有。
发表评论 取消回复